A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

本帖最后由 武汉学工部 于 2021-9-24 21:19 编辑

不忘初心,方得始终
                                     ——Java就业131期戚同学

       光阴似箭,岁月如梭,不知不觉在黑马学习JAVA已经四个月了,还有两个月就要毕业了,这四个月,无论是技术,还是学习体会,收获都很大,在这将这些学习心得体会与已经在黑马学习的、或即将要来黑马学习的小伙伴们共勉。
       先说一下在黑马的学习进程。
       第一阶段是JAVA基础及基础进阶的知识,这个阶段都是新的概念,刚开始会不适应,过几天就好了,代码刚开始还是有点意思的。这个阶段刚开始接触数组和面向对象,可能有点不好理解,对于刚开始接触这些知识的同学可能会有点吃力,但不要慌,经过时间的洗礼最后会发现,这些东西都是小kiss,后面你都不把这些东西放在眼里。
       第二阶段讲的是一些前端的知识、主流框架—ssm,学完这些你就知道前后端是怎么进行数据交互,这个阶段很重要,要认真学。前端的东西不需要你学得特别好,只需你认识一些简单的标签,知道怎么在xue里面写一个方法发送请求,然后把后端返回的数据给前端vue里面data属性绑定的一个属性赋值就行了。后端最重要的是三层架构,再就是数据库的一些curd操作了,三层架构无论如何你都要滚瓜烂熟,不然六个月基本是白学了,啥也干不了。当然,这个极端代码bug是最多的,因为前后端整合了,会有各种问题。不要慌,出现的问题有可能是涉及到你的知识盲区,得多多请教老师和其他学习吸收比较好的同学,也有可能是你的业务逻辑没搞清楚,代码出现bug,自己都不知道从哪里下手去解决,保持良好的代码习惯会让你少出现很多低级错误。
       最后就是我现在所处的第三阶段,这个阶段会将其他技术整合到项目里,优化我们开发的项目。
       接下来分享一下自己的学习方法和体会吧。
       首先,不忘初心,方得始终。刚开始进来的时候混身是学习劲儿,但是六个月的学习,如何保持一个好的学习状态真的不容易,这也是决定你最终能力高低决定性因素之一。可能来黑马之前,一没有了解相关知识,但这并不影响你成为一个优秀的程序员,学习了一段时间你可能会发现,自己学习起来很吃力,不过那些和你一样没有接触这些相关方面知识以及那些自学很长一段时间的同学学起来就特别轻松,不要气馁,想一下,都是交了那么多钱来一个地方学习的,他们牛逼、有天赋,怎么还和你一样交那么多钱来一起学习,肯定是有原因的,所以,保持一个好的学习状态才是最好的天赋。黑马的学习进程还是很快的,一个星期会讲完一个大的知识点,自学的人可能要学一个月,还掌握不好。再次重申一遍,保持一个好的学习状态,蓄势待发。
       黑马的课程早上会有早读,第一阶段和第二阶段会背单词,单词很重要,这个真的靠你自己多背多记一些,多认识一些单词,认识的越多对你理解很多的东西都会有帮助,我背单词会把自己那些不认识的单词抄下来,然后边写边读,不能懒,至少我现在发现,班里掌握知识不太好的同学英语单词记的肯定不好,真的不要觉得自己英语差然后没办法,那只是你懒的借口,就那么简单。白天学习的时候,学新东西我会拿草稿纸写写记一记,有时候也会画一些流程图或者思维导图,便于自己理解记忆,吃饭的时候想一想白天学了些什么,然后心里面说一下学的东西是个啥,如果想不出来就记得回去看一下。晚上有很长时间给我们消化吸收白天的东西,老师晚自习会总结白天学的东西,布置作业,晚自习是最重要的,我第一阶段晚上一般都是把白天的代码敲完,然后做作业,接着把白天学的东西按照自己的理解写成一篇文章发布到自己的CSDN播客上去,有时间再去看一看。也会预习明天的课程,不过不会看太多,大概知道要讲什么东西就行。第一阶段有很充足的时间去整理学习的东西,第二阶段就是阶段性的总结了,完成作业会有一点小小的挑战,没有太多的时间去预习。到第三阶段,我整理文章的习惯因为时间关系都已经没有了。
      最后讲一下敲代码的一些习惯吧,这个可以拿我遇到的两个同座来比较,效果真的很明显,就刚开始敲一些简单的代码时候我的a同座写注释比我一个大学四年计算机本科专业的都写的好,虽然我写注释的习惯,但是你看他写的代码就特别舒服,有空行有注释变量名起的也是见名知意起变量名需要多一点单词咯,不然都是一些abcd和中文拼音。。。b同,代码风格,没空行没注释,起变量名就不说了,有时候他问我代码出现的bug是什么的时候,我一看过去,一大坨,长短不一,字母也是一个a一个b的,那叫一个看的难受啊,看完bug找半天才找到问题。每次敲完练习都会欣赏a同学敲代码,期待他问我一个问题,让我内心得到一些满足,哈哈哈,不过现实大部分都是b摸摸我的手说,诶,哥们,帮我看一下这是什么问题,怎么和老师敲的一模一样,还是出不来结果。。。所以建议刚开始学习的同志们还是养成良好的代码风格,空行和注释以及多几个字母不会占用你电脑太多的内存空间。多琢磨琢磨一些原理性的知识,不要局限于仅仅会敲完这段代码执行结果。多琢磨,不要觉得自己很厉害,不服别人比你强,互帮互助最后大家都会有好的收获
        最后,愿黑马莘莘学子都找到自己心仪的工作,不忘初心,方能始终。


0 个回复

您需要登录后才可以回帖 登录 | 加入黑马